Is there a currency built into Inform 7 or available via an extension? It seems like there must be, but I can’t find one.

I’m looking for something that allows attributing a cost to items and manages the player’s bankroll (deducting when taking an item, preventing taking an item that can be afforded, etc.).

I’ll put together an extension and share it if this isn’t already available, but want to save myself the effort if it already exists.


It’s certainly not built-in, and I can’t recall hearing of any Inform 7 extension to the purpose (nor find one on the extensions site).

(There is a “Money” library extension for Inform 6, though.)

If you do go ahead and write an extension, I suppose it would be nice if it could easily be customized so that the end author could choose the name of his currency (dollars, euros, yuan, pounds, dubloons, gold pieces, credits, galleons, cash, or whatever) and, if the extension handles systems with several units (dollars and cents; pounds, shillings, and pence; galleons, sickles, and knuts), determine the exchange rate between the units.

There’s no extension for this, but there are several examples in the Recipe Book.